AELER is a Lausanne-based company that aims to upgrade the infrastructure of global supply chains by building an ecosystem of technologies around the shipping container. Its mission is to reinvent the container so it becomes stronger, better insulated, 'super smart', more sustainable, and capable of higher payloads for a wide range of industries. AELER’s Unit One 20ft container is described as being made from advanced composite materials, with native insulation to help protect cargo from temperature changes, and integrated IoT sensors enabling near real-time tracking and monitoring.
In addition to the container hardware, AELER offers a digital platform called Control Tower, positioned as a 'digital all-in-one platform' that provides multimodal visibility into a cargo’s health and location, along with real-time alerts for proactive logistics management. AELER also presents a 'Container as a Service' model (CaaS), described as letting customers collect, use, and drop off containers at global depots. The company describes its approach as supporting environmental sustainability in shipping while improving operational efficiency, safety, and digital capabilities.
